What this video covers
Jaimie and Jay of Wicked Makers walk viewers through their 2022 'Oakview Cemetery' yard haunt, built and refined over six-plus years, covering both daytime and nighttime perspectives. The sprawling display blends custom-built props and animatronic makeovers across multiple themed zones — from a spooky graveyard with a chicken-wire ghost and a Pennywise character, to a pirate skeleton party, a swamp witch scene, and a giant spider installation. A highlight is a stone portal with custom and AtmosFX projections, framed by oversized store-bought skeletons that have been repositioned for maximum impact. The tour wraps with their most feared character, the Sitting Scarecrow, who serves as the final scare for trick-or-treaters.

Making a Giant Spider! 🕷 DIY Halloween Props
Wicked Makers' Jay and Jaimie build 'Gertie,' a giant Halloween spider prop using chicken wire as a structural armature, pipe insulation for the legs, and expanding spray foam for the body texture. The build is designed to be approachable for beginners, relying on materials readily available at hardware stores. Painting and decorative detailing bring the oversized arachnid to life as a dramatic yard haunt centerpiece. The creators note that the chicken-wire-plus-foam technique is highly adaptable for many other DIY Halloween props.

Endless Drinking Skeleton 💀 DIY Halloween Props
Wicked Makers' Jaimie and Jay walk through building 'Barty,' a Pirates of the Caribbean-inspired pirate skeleton prop that appears to endlessly drink from a bottle using a hidden recirculating fountain pump. The build centers on a life-sized skeleton dressed in thrift-store pirate gear posed over a barrel, with colored water looping invisibly through vinyl tubing. The hosts also highlight how the same fountain-pump trick can be adapted to other Halloween themes — vampires, zombies, witches — making the core technique highly reusable.
